CRAVINGS: SCAMPI PIE NOT A TRIVIAL MATTER

101816rubino-9392577PieHole catches Jen Rubino pre-bite at Jamian’s Food and Drink. (Photo by Susan Ericson. Click to enlarge)

By SUSAN ERICSON

piehole_cravings-1447600Jamian’s Food and Drink gets testy on Tuesday nights as brainiacs and know-it-alls vie for points at a trivia contest that fills the Red Bank bar to capacity.

Jen Rubino, a 43-year-old borough resident and Italian teacher, has been showing up with her team from the beginning of the weekly showdown two years ago. Is it the camaraderie, the challenge — or maybe a craving for her favorite pizza that brings her out every week?
102316jamians-500x281-3161760Shrimp scampi pizza is a popular item on the menu at Jamian’s Food and Drink. (Photo by Susan Ericson. Click to enlarge)

The waitress delivers the pizza to the table and Rubino grabs a slice. She takes a bite that elicits a moan of appreciation.

“It’s not a very traditional pie, but I like the way that they make the scampi part of it,” Rubino says. “It’s like, if you’re into shrimp scampi, you don’t have to dip the bread into the sauce. The bread is already a part of the pizza.”

The 14-inch bar-style pie has a crispy, thin crust topped with a creamy, cheesy garlic sauce. Big chunks of shrimp finish off the top of the pizza.

Jamian’s Food and Drink is open from 11 a.m. to 2 a.m. weekdays and opens at noon on the weekend. A shrimp scampi pie will set you back $16. Do you have a special Craving? Tell us all about it: [email protected].
